In Betting Pools



1. Payout Structures:
- Betting pools often have a predetermined payout structure, where the total pool amount is divided among winners based on their stakes.
- Example: A typical betting pool might distribute 70% of the pool to the winner and 30% to second place.

2. Odds Calculation:
- Odds are calculated based on the number of participants and the total amount wagered, affecting potential payouts.

How are poolresults calculated in betting?

Poolresults in betting are calculated by aggregating all bets placed, then deducting the house take or fees, and finally distributing the remaining amount among the winners based on their share of the total pool.

Are poolresults the same for all betting platforms?

No, poolresults can vary across different betting platforms due to differences in the number of participants, the amount wagered, and the house percentage taken from the pool.
